Udemy: Democratizing Education for All
Udemy has established itself as a leading online learning platform by focusing on accessibility and affordability. Here’s how Udemy is making a difference:
- 1. A Vast Course Library
Udemy offers a vast library of courses across numerous fields. With over 185,000 courses available, learners can find resources on virtually any topic. This extensive selection enables users to explore new areas of interest or deepen their expertise in a particular field.
- 2. Affordable Pricing
One of Udemy’s most attractive features is its pricing model. Most courses are offered at a one-time fee, and frequent discounts and promotions make learning more affordable. This pay-once approach ensures that learners have lifetime access to course materials, including updates and additional resources.
- 3. Diverse Instructors
Udemy features courses taught by a wide array of instructors from different backgrounds and industries. This diversity ensures that learners are exposed to various perspectives and teaching styles. Many instructors are industry professionals who bring practical, real-world experience to their courses.
- 4. User Reviews and Ratings
Before enrolling in a course, learners can review ratings and feedback from other students. This transparency helps users make informed decisions and choose courses that best meet their learning goals.
- 5. Practical Learning
Udemy emphasizes practical, hands-on learning. Many courses include projects, quizzes, and assignments that enable learners to apply their knowledge in real-world scenarios. This practical approach enhances the learning experience and ensures that students can immediately use their new skills.
Coursera: Bridging the Gap Between Academia and Industry
Coursera stands out for its collaboration with top universities and institutions, offering a blend of academic rigor and practical relevance. Here’s why Coursera is a game-changer:
- 1. Partnerships with Top Institutions
Coursera partners with prestigious universities and organizations, including Stanford, Yale, and Google. These collaborations ensure that the courses are of high quality and align with current industry standards. Learners benefit from the expertise of leading educators and industry professionals.
- 2. Specializations and Professional Certificates
Coursera offers Specializations and Professional Certificates that provide comprehensive learning paths. Specializations consist of a series of related courses designed to build expertise in a specific area, while Professional Certificates focus on skills required for specific job roles. These credentials enhance employability and career advancement.
3. Flexible Learning Paths
Coursera’s flexible learning options cater to diverse needs. Learners can choose from individual courses, Specializations, or full degree programs. This flexibility allows students to tailor their education to their personal and professional goals.
- 4. Financial Aid and Scholarships
To make education more accessible, Coursera offers financial aid and scholarships for many courses. This support helps learners who may face financial barriers to pursue their educational goals.
- 5. Global Reach and Multi-Language Support
Coursera’s global reach ensures that learners from around the world can access high-quality education. Many courses are available in multiple languages, broadening the platform’s accessibility and inclusivity.

- 2. Pricing
- Udemy: Courses are available at a one-time fee with frequent discounts. Once purchased, learners have lifetime access to the course material.
- Coursera: Courses can be audited for free, but a fee is required for official certifications or degrees. Coursera also offers financial aid for eligible learners.
- 3. Course Variety
- Udemy: Features a broad range of courses, including niche topics and practical skills. Ideal for learners seeking specific skills or hobbies.
- Coursera: Focuses on comprehensive educational experiences, including degree programs and professional certificates. Suitable for those seeking formal qualifications or in-depth learning.
